Overview

This online training offers a practical introduction to artificial intelligence and the EU’s AI Act. It explains how AI and Generative AI work, outlines the EU’s risk‑based regulatory framework, and clarifies what the Act requires from organizations and employees. Across five concise modules, the course builds essential AI literacy skills by focusing on responsible use of AI tools, safe handling of input and output data, ethical and legal considerations, and the importance of maintaining human oversight. By the end of the course, learners understand how to use AI effectively, critically, and responsibly without diminishing their own role or expertise.

For Whom?

This course is intended for anyone who uses or plans to use AI tools at work and needs foundational AI knowledge as well as the mandatory AI literacy training required under the EU’s AI Act.

Course Description & Learning Outcomes

  • Understand the fundamentals of AI and Generative AI, including how different AI models work and their common applications. 

  • Gain a clear overview of the EU AI Act, its risk‑based framework, and the obligations it sets for organizations and users.

  • Learn how to use AI tools responsibly, including safe and ethical handling of input data and careful evaluation of AI‑generated outputs. 

  • Develop essential AI literacy skills required under the EU AI Act, with emphasis on human oversight, critical thinking, and understanding AI’s limitations.
